#7f2857 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f2857 is composed of 49.8% red, 15.7%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.5% magenta, 31.5%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 327.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 32.7%. #7f2857 color hex could be obtained by blending #fe50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#7f2857 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#7f2857 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f2857 has RGB values of R:127, G:40,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.31,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8333399.

Shades and Tints of #7f2857
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080205 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f2857
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#584f54 is the less saturated color, while #a6015a is the most saturated one.
